Kitchen Faucet Installation in Denver, CO
Kitchen faucet install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ing faucets or installing new units to improve functionality and style in a kitchen. These projects typically include removing old fixtures, ensuring proper connections to water supply lines, and securing the new faucet in place. Homeowners often request this service when upgrading their kitchen design, fixing leaks, or replacing worn-out fixtures to enhance convenience and aesthetics.
Before requesting kitchen faucet installation, property owners usually want to understand the compatibility of the new faucet with their sink, the types of finishes available, and any specific features they desire, such as pull-down sprayers or touchless operation. It’s also helpful to consider the plumbing configuration and whether additional modifications are needed to ensure the new fixture functions properly and meets personal preferences.

Kitchen Faucet Installation Questions
What types of kitchen faucets can be installed? A variety of styles including single-handle, double-handle, pull-down, and touchless faucets can be installed to suit different preferences and needs.
Is it necessary to shut off the water supply for installation? Yes, the water supply should be turned off to ensure a safe and proper installation process.
Can existing plumbing affect faucet installation? Existing plumbing conditions may influence installation options and procedures, especially if upgrades are needed.
What should homeowners consider before installing a new kitchen faucet? Consider the faucet style, finish, and compatibility with existing sink and plumbing to ensure a smooth installation.
